His market value was already 300,000 euros: ex-professional strengthened state league Oberweikertshofen

Sporting Director Uli Bergmann, Dominik Widemann and Head of Soccer Martin Steininger sealed the cooperation with a handshake.

© Dieter Metzler

SC Oberweikertshofen has landed a real top-class player in former professional striker Dominik Widemann.

Oberweikertshofen – Last Sunday, the 25-year-old, together with his brother Sascha, coach of the Puchheim district league women, and girlfriend Hanna followed the SCO test match against Türkgücü to take a close look at his new teammates.

"We consider ourselves lucky to have made such a good transfer," said the SCO's sporting director, Uli Bergmann.

"In addition, Dominik is a player from the region who was already on the ball at a higher level.

That quite simply raises the quality in the team again.”

Dominik's brother Sascha Widemann also had a large part in the transfer.

"I remember him from my Wildenroth days," says Bergmann.

"But we also had the feeling that Dominik and his girlfriend Hanna felt right at home in Oberweikertshofen." Nevertheless, one thing is clear: the club can only handle a transfer like this with the help of local companies and private individuals who have been supporting the SCO for years .

Widemann took his first steps at TSV Moorenweis

Dominik Widemann spent his first years as a footballer at TSV Moorenweis and SC Fürstenfeldbruck.

But as a junior, the talent switched to SpVgg Unterhaching.

Then it went straight to the 2nd Bundesliga at FC Heidenheim.

At that time, his market value also jumped to the highest sum of 300,000 euros.

After three years in Heidenheim, Widemann returned to Unterhaching, only to switch to the third division of the Kickers in Würzburg just one season later.

A season at SG Sonnenhof Großaspach in the Regionalliga Südwest followed.

Most recently, Widemann wore the jersey for TSV Rain, where the contract of the 1.80 meter tall striker expires on June 30th.

Going back from professional football to amateur football isn't a problem for him. "I'm studying sports management for the time being, and meanwhile I'm living with my parents in Grunertshofen, so the SCO suits me well in terms of distance," says Dominik Widemann.

The talks with coach Dominik Sammer and Bergmann convinced him.

"Of course, when you've played at a higher level, you want to help the team to progress.

I want to support the team to achieve their goals." (Dieter Metzler)
